You can buy additional Gateways to connect your Oracle server to other datasources, but since SQL Server can connect to any ODBC datasource you may be able to export your data this way.

Regards

   Roger

BTW: Since I'm using SQL server 7.0 I'm not sure if 6.5 can connect to other ODBC datasources. The connection from SQL Server 7.0 to Oracle works.
